For a Trust
-
-
Trust deed, or other founding document, in terms of which the trust is created.
-
Letters of Authority issued by the Master of the High Court where the Trust was registered (or equivalent document, for international trusts).
-
Contact details (i.e. telephone number, e-mail address, etc). Does not need to be verified.
